Tigers Run Strong at Wabash Hokum Karem

CRAWFORDSVILLE, Ind. - The Wittenberg Tigers ran well in their first meet under Head Coach Craig Penney, who took over the program less a month earlier, as the men took fifth place against an outstanding field in the Wabash Hokum-Karem. The Tiger women placed third in a similarly strong field.

The event features an unusual format with runners from each team paired up as relay partners. The Tigers' top finish was turned in on the men's side as sophomores Benjamin McCombs (Columbus, Ohio/Upper Arlington) and Gabe Savage (Lewisburg, Ohio/Tri-County North) placed 12th with a combined time in the 2x3 mile race of 30:28. Juniors Mike Echols (Springfield, Ohio/North) and Mike Wismer (Avon, Ohio/Avon) were Wittenberg's next finisher in 20th place.

On the women's side, Wittenberg's top relay duo was formed by sophomore Katie McIlvain (East Liverpool, Ohio/East Liverpool) and senior Christine Maddox (Miamisburg, Ohio/Miamisburg), who turned in a combined time in the 2x2 mile race of 25:11. Junior Megan Poling (Medina, Ohio/Highland) and sophomore Abby McCutcheon (Lancaster, Ohio/Lancaster) placed 20th.
